GKN Aerospace congratulates the Mitsubishi Aircraft Corporation on the successful completion of the first flight of its next-generation regional jet. GKN Aerospace supplies critical components for the engine that powers the Mitsubishi Regional Jet (MRJ) as well as market-leading windows for the aircraft's passenger cabin. GKN Aerospace is responsible for the design and manufacture of the turbine exhaust case (TEC) and intermediate compressor case (IMC) for Pratt & Whitney on the PurePower PW1200G engine. The company also produces the engine's low pressure turbine (LPT) shaft and fan case mount rings.
In the MRJ passenger cabin, GKN Aerospace is responsible for the windows which are coated with the company's patented CrystalVue II abrasion-resistant coating and provide greatly improved light transmission and optical clarity. CrystalVue II coatings can also manage the impact of solar heat and prevent electromagnetic interference.
